Grille:
So my lights are currently 1000 miles away from me being modified and painted black, so I decided to paint my grille in my downtime. The bumper was already off for the lights so I pulled the grille off and painted it with plastidip, then clear coated it with plasti dip glossifier. I think it came out pretty nice.

Cats:
So the absolute last engine mod I wanted to do before my tune was get some HFC's. I'm getting a tune within the coming weeks so the search was on. I found a set of Stillen HFC's on here for $250 and snatched them up quick. Then came the install process...
Passenger side took me 1 hour, relatively straight forward. But when I got to the driver's side, I encountered my new nemesis, the demon bolt (google it). I've never had a bolt that was such a pain in my *** in my life. 3 hours of torching and trying to break it did nothing. I put a TON of PB Blaster on it and let it sit overnight. Tried again this morning and NOTHING.
I cut the son of a bitch right off by the upper flange and STILL couldn't get the bolt out. I torched it and broke it off with a hammer. 6 hours spent on one bolt, but now my HFC's are in and HOLY ****
My car sounds like a jet engine now, it's scary loud. Butt dyno doesn't notice too much in terms of improvement because I'm intoxicated by the sound. I don't have any pics but I'm gonna try to get a video soon.
